Scott F. McCrossin is the President and Owner of SFM Financial
Planning. He began his career over 22 years ago at the public accounting
firm, Coopers and Lybrand (now PriceWaterhouse Coopers). After working
as a financial analyst at Shearson Lehman, Scott began a long, successful
career at Smith Barney. While there, he became the assistant to the
Vice Chairman of Smith Barney. During this time, Scott earned his
MBA in Finance from New York University’s Stern School of Business
while part of their Executive MBA Program. After graduating from this
program, he transferred to the portfolio management division of Smith
Barney and became a senior research analyst. In this position, Scott
was responsible for researching companies with the goal of successfully
identifying stocks to portfolio managers for inclusion in client portfolios.
Based on his success as a senior research analyst, Scott was promoted
to the position of portfolio manager. As a portfolio manager, he was
responsible for the investment portfolios of high net worth individuals
and large institutions ultimately managing approximately $850 million
in client assets. The Asset Management division of Smith Barney/Citigroup
was then sold to Legg Mason where he continued on as a portfolio manager.
Scott's desire to offer unbiased independent financial planning at
a reasonable cost ultimately led to his departure from the corporate
world to establish SFM Financial Planning.
